JOB DESCRIPTION SUMMARY
The Human Resources Coordinator provides support to the overall Human Resources function and will work directly with the HR Generalist and report to the Director of
HR. SCOPE OF DUTIES
The duties of the Human Resources Coordinator shall include, but are not necessarily limited to the following: Responsible for the administrative support of day-to-day Human Resources functions including new hire onboarding activity, employment change processing, employee file maintenance, and coordination of special projects and events. Performs a wide range of administrative duties which require accuracy, and at times, discretion and strict confidentiality. Assists in creating and revising job descriptions for new and existing positions. Provides support in assisting employees and the management team with the understanding and application of human resources related policies and procedures. Maintains employment records through computer entry and file upkeep. Assists with employee data in Human Resources and Payroll databases. Assists with implementing the company’s drug and alcohol testing program. Possesses the ability to work in a fast-paced, results-oriented and customer service-focused work environment. Works independently as well collaboratively towards team and organizational goals and demonstrates good judgment with excellent follow through. Establishes appropriate fleet service and staffing levels; monitors and evaluates resources and procedures; allocates resources accordingly. Keeps abreast in understanding industry practices and trends in HR. Complies with all state and federal regulations. All other HR related projects as directed by management.
